Definition of renewalist in English: renewalistnoun rɪˈnjuːəlɪst 1An advocate or adherent of a new or restored (especially religious) system or practice; a reformist. 2Christian Church. Also with capital initial. An advocate or member of the charismatic movement; an adherent of charismatic renewal.
adjective rɪˈnjuːəlɪst Of, relating to, or characteristic of renewalism or renewalists.
Origin 1960s. From renewal + -ist, after renewalism.
